  • Squid (UK)

    “It’s probably no surprise to hear that live music and the community they offer are very very important to us. Some of our earliest gigs in Brighton and London at venues like Green Door Store, The Hope and Ruin and The Windmill were vital for getting our name out there but more importantly letting us figure out what kind of band we wanted to be. Some of our earliest gigs were pretty bad, but these venues let us perform regardless as we clumsily “found our sound”. Not only this, but the social aspect to independent venues is also so incredibly important. I’ve met some of my best friends at music venues, mainly because they’re usually spaces where I can be myself and are (usually) full of people who I can get on with.”
